Doble filtrado de datos en ListBox mediante combobox

Tengo una planilla de excel, en el cual como podrán observar puedo filtrar los datos en un listbox según el combobox que elija, mi pregunta es se puede hacer un doble filtrado, en el caso de que elija un combobox primero me muestre los datos en el listbox y que al elegir otro combobox esos datos me los vuelva a filtrar, como si fuera un doble filtrado. Ejemplo primero filtro por propietario me muestre los datos del propietario y que luego esos datos filtrados en el listbox los vuelva a filtrar según otro combobox como el por Proveedor. Adjunto Excel en el siguiente link

https://mega.co.nz/#!J1khwBJR!qHOZapWG1WwWB4QRuxoG_e8jWobw3SqjvAL8ZpYyLWs

2 respuestas

Respuesta
5

Te anexo el archivo con el código adaptado para que filtres por los 2 combos.

https://www.dropbox.com/s/zrkh4dnazxxpcbn/Combustibles%20Vehiculos%20dam.xls

Nota: Te puse un ejemplo para validar números en el textbox3

Respuesta

Me parece genial (ambos formularios).. es casi lo que necesito, obvio lo tengo que adaptar, pero asi, de entrada no me filtra por fechas.. estoy haciendo algo mal... (pongo las fechas de la planilla).. es decir, validas.

EN algunos casos filtra, pero siempre con error... Yo justo necesito filtrar por fechas! Agradezco ayuda

If CDate(ActiveCell.Offset(0, 2)) >= CDate(TextBox3 & Label23 & TextBox5 & Label24 & TextBox6) And CDate(ActiveCell.Offset(0, 2)) <= CDate(TextBox4 & Label25 & TextBox7 & Label26 & TextBox8) Then
ListBox1. AddItem ActiveCell

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as